On Sunday, September 7, the SkiErg Open kicks off at the Craft Arena in Kosta. It will be the first official SkiErg competition on Swedish soil, and the start list features several stars.

The format includes a 5000-meter prologue with ten competitors per heat. The ten best times will qualify for the final, which will also be contested with a mass start, just like the prologue.

Distance

  • 5000 meters in both prologue and final
  • The 10 best times qualify for the final
  • Mass start in both the prologue and the final

Start Times

  • Women’s prologue: 10:00 CET
  • Men’s prologue: 12:00 CET
  • Finals: 17:00 CET

Pro Team stars on the start line

Several Pro Team stars will be present at the SkiErg Open. Among them are Vasaloppet winners Emil Persson and Andreas Nygaard. Norwegian Mathias Aas Rolid enters as the favorite, having set this year’s fastest time over 5000 meters: 16:06.

Rolid will attempt to beat the current World Record of 15:55.9. Also on the start list are Runar Skaug Mathiesen, winner of Marcialonga last year, and Ski Classics overall champion Ole Jørgen Bruvoll.

On the women’s side, the fastest time belongs to Tjejvasan 2026 winner Jenny Larsson (18:23), who also holds the World Record. She will be challenged by Ski Classics overall winner Anikken Gjerde Alnæs, as well as Karolina Hedenström and Hanna Lodin.
